Summary

Dr. Qianwen Zhang is an Assistant Professor at Mississippi State University.

Her research is focusing on Organic Agriculture, Biostimulant Application, Controlled Environment Agriculture, Hydroponics, Analytical Chemistry, Food Science, Microbiology, and Sensory Evaluation.

I am a researcher investigating the synergy between organic practices, biostimulants, controlled environment agriculture, and hydroponics to create sustainable horticultural systems that produce nutrient-rich fruits and vegetables.
